Output 289c06b63fd7b85ba921216033fe2a09ec7b7d524ff950a308cc986d91f5d9db:4

value
44160705
script pubkey
OP_0 OP_PUSHBYTES_20 01e0384080a0d153bf3cf93ef30d16fbf30e6d7e
address
bc1qq8srssyq5rg480eulyl0xrgkl0esumt7paxnjw
transaction
289c06b63fd7b85ba921216033fe2a09ec7b7d524ff950a308cc986d91f5d9db
spent
true